The Spaceborne Microwave Radiometer is the main payload of the meteorological satellite and marine satellite, which provides one of the most important remote sensing methods to monitor the weather and disaster, detect the ocean, hydrology and geophysical process in our country. The Scanning Servo System is an important component part of the microwave radiometer, which can drive the antenna to scan the earth field correctly and reliably according to a strict time and space sequence.This article is based on the developing project in the payload of satellite, in which the system composition, implementation principle and method of spaceborne scanning servo system are thoroughly discussed. And it also provides the general design scheme of a spaceborne scanning servo system, design and accomplishes the Control Circuit, Two-phase Hybrid Stepping Motor, Angle Measuring Channle and Servo System Software of the system. All of these design and implementation has satisfied and improved the requirements of the payload of satellite. The correctness and effectiveness of the system has proved by some experiments.
